Definitions3.1 Turn Signal FlasherA device installed in a vehicle lighting system which has the primary function ofcausing the turn signal lam
9、ps to flash when the turn signal switch is actuated. Secondary functions mayinclude the visible pilot indication for the turn signal system (required by SAE J910) and an audible signal toindicate when the flasher is operating.3.2 Hazard Warning Signal FlasherA device installed in a vehicle lighting
10、system which has the primaryfunction of causing all of the turn signal lamps to flash when the hazard warning switch is actuated. Secondary functions may include the visible pilot indication for the hazard warning signal system (required bySAE J910) and an audible signal to indicate when the flasher
11、 is operating.3.3 Combination FlasherA device which satisfies all the turn signal and hazard warning requirements of thisdocument. These devices are used on vehicles whose operation or mode of operation presents a variableelectrical load to the flasher.3.4 Warning Lamp Alternating FlasherA device in
12、stalled in a vehicle lighting system which has the primaryfunction of causing warning lamps to alternately flash when the system is actuated. Secondary functions mayinclude the visible pilot(s) indication for the warning system and an audible signal to indicate when the flasheris operating (recommen
13、ded by SAE J887 and J595).3.5 ”Class A“ FlashersFlashers designed to perform in vehicles whose expected life or mode of operationrequires a flasher with normal durability. Examples of these vehicles are passenger cars and light-duty trucks.3.6 “Class B“ FlashersFlashers designed to perform in vehicl
14、es whose expected life or mode of operationrequires a flasher with extended durability. Examples of these vehicles are heavy-duty trucks, buses, andtaxicabs.4. Tests5.1 Test EquipmentThe standard test equipment and circuitry for performing flasher tests shall conform withthe specifications in SAE J823, Flasher Test Equipment.5.2 Test ProceduresAll of the following tests shall be perf
16、ormed at 12.8 V for nominal 12 V devices, 6.4 V fornominal 6 V devices and 25.6 V for nominal 24 V devices and at an ambient temperature of 24 C 5 Cunless otherwise specified.COPYRIGHT Society of Automotive Engineers, Inc.Licensed by Information Handling ServicesCOPYRIGHT Society of Automotive Engin
17、eers, Inc.Licensed by Information Handling ServicesSAE J1690 Issued AUG96-3 -5.2.1 START TIME5.2.1.1 Turn Signal, Hazard Warning Signal, and Combination FlashersThe start time of a normally closed typeflasher is the time to open the circuit after the voltage is applied, provided the closed circuit r
18、emains closed fora minimum of 0.10 s. If the closed circuit opens in less then 0.10 s, the flasher shall be considered a normallyopen type flasher for this test. The start time of a normally open type flasher is the time to complete one cycle(close the circuit and then open the circuit) after the vo
19、ltage is applied. For a fixed load flasher, the test shallbe made with the specific ampere design load connected. For a variable load flasher, the test shall be madewith the minimum and maximum ampere design loads for both the turn and hazard warning signal functions.The start time shall be measured
20、 and recorded for three starts, each of which is separated by a coolinginterval of at least 5 min.5.2.1.2 Warning Lamp Alternating FlashersThe start time is the time to complete one cycle (both load circuitshave been energized and de-energized) after voltage is applied to the flasher. For fixed load
21、 flashers, the testshall be conducted with the specific ampere design loads connected. For a variable load flasher, the test shallbe conducted with both the minimum and maximum ampere design loads connected. The start time shall bemeasured and recorded for three starts, each of which is separated by
22、 a cooling interval of at least 5 min.5.2.2 VOLTAGE DROP5.2.2.1 Turn Signal, Hazard Warning Signal, and Combination FlashersThe lowest voltage drop across theflasher shall be measured between the input and the load terminals at the flasher and during the “on“ period. The voltage drop shall be measur
23、ed and recorded during any three cycles after the flasher has been operatingfor five consecutive cycles. For a fixed load flasher, the test shall be made with the specific ampere designload connected. For a variable load flasher, the test shall be made with the maximum ampere design loadconnected.5.
24、2.2.2 Warning Lamp Alternating FlashersThe lowest voltage drop across the flasher shall be measuredbetween the input and each load terminal at the flasher and during the “on“ period. The voltage drop shall bemeasured and recorded during any three cycles after the flasher has been operating for five
